Comprehensive, practical, lively and accessible, Working with Spoken Discourse is the much-loved benchmark for learning to do discourse analysis. It combines theory and practice to give students the grounding they need in practical techniques of analyzing talk and how to apply them to real data.



  • Begins with the ‘why’ and ‘how’ of doing discourse analysis

  • Packs examples into every chapter to help explain complex concepts

  • Uses exercises and activities to reinforce what you’ve learned

  • Leads you through the practicalities of designing your own project


Exceptionally clear, and perfect for undergraduates starting a project, this is the essential guide to spoken discourse.

Sobre o autor

Deborah Cameron teaches at Oxford University, where she is Professor of Language and Communication. Her main research interests are in sociolinguistics, discourse analysis and the study of gender and sexuality; her previous publications include Working with Spoken Discourse (2001) and Working with Written Discourse (with Ivan Panovic, 2014), Good to Talk? (2000), The Myth of Mars and Venus (2007), and Verbal Hygiene (1995/2012).
